Fire broke out in the green space near Elephant Rock, in the municipality of Castelsardo, right at the foot of the UNESCO World Heritage site . On-site, in the Coinsar area, CVSM personnel (the Volunteer Maritime Rescue Corps) responded once again to put out the flames. Two car tires had reportedly been set alight, not far from already dry hedges and close to Mediterranean scrub at risk of fire spread.
This is the third time in just a few months . "We are here," say the CVSM volunteers, "but perhaps it's time to start asking some questions and condemn these senseless and unjustified acts against our territory." The fire was immediately extinguished, but the risk remains for the Elephant Rock site, which houses two Domus de Janas, excavated on different levels. It is one of the emblems of Castelsardo, located in the Multeddu area, at km 4.3 of the state road 134, which connects the tourist village to the municipality of Sedini.
